The demand for faster, more reliable wireless communication technologies continues to surge. One such technology that is rapidly gaining traction is Ultra Wideband (UWB). UWB is a short-range wireless communication protocol that utilizes a large portion of the radio spectrum to transmit data over short distances with high precision and low power consumption. This technology has a myriad of applications, ranging from indoor positioning and asset tracking to secure keyless entry systems and smart home devices.

The global ultra wideband chipset market is experiencing robust growth, driven by the increasing adoption of UWB technology across various industries. According to recent market research, the UWB chipset market is projected to witness substantial expansion in the coming years, with a compound annual growth rate (CAGR) exceeding 20%.

One of the key drivers propelling the growth of the UWB chipset market is the rising demand for accurate indoor positioning and location-based services. With the proliferation of Internet of Things (IoT) devices and smart infrastructure, there is a growing need for precise localization capabilities in indoor environments. UWB technology offers centimeter-level accuracy, making it ideal for applications such as asset tracking, inventory management, and indoor navigation systems.

Moreover, UWB's inherent security features have made it an attractive choice for applications requiring secure and reliable wireless communication. Its ability to accurately measure distances between devices helps prevent unauthorized access and enhances the security of keyless entry systems and electronic locks.

Furthermore, the automotive industry is emerging as a significant growth driver for the UWB chipset market. With the increasing integration of advanced driver assistance systems (ADAS) and in-vehicle connectivity features, automakers are turning to UWB technology to enable secure vehicle-to-everything (V2X) communication and enhance vehicle safety and convenience.
